HDPE Duct Spacers in Construction Projects

In the construction industry, proper spacing of ductwork is crucial for both safety and efficiency. HDPE duct spacers are essential for maintaining the integrity of underground utility installations. They prevent the ducts from shifting or collapsing under heavy loads, ensuring that the utility systems function effectively over time. HDPE duct spacer manufacturers produce a range of sizes and designs to meet the unique needs of construction projects, enabling contractors to select the most suitable option for their specific requirements.

Impact on Utility Installations

HDPE duct spacers play a critical role in utility installations, such as water, gas, and telecommunications systems. The durability and resistance to chemical degradation make HDPE an ideal material for underground applications. Spacers not only provide structural support but also promote proper airflow and drainage around the ducts. This is particularly important in regions prone to flooding or heavy rainfall, where proper drainage can significantly extend the lifespan of utility systems. The versatility of HDPE duct spacers means they can be tailored to fit various utility types, making them a valuable asset for utility companies.

Benefits in Telecommunication Systems

In the realm of telecommunications, the need for reliable and efficient duct systems has never been greater. As the demand for data and communication services increases, so does the need for effective duct management. HDPE duct spacers assist in organizing and supporting the numerous cables and conduits that are integral to telecommunication networks. By keeping these components separated and aligned, HDPE duct spacers minimize interference and enhance the overall performance of the network. The flexibility of HDPE also allows manufacturers to create customized solutions tailored to the specific requirements of telecom projects.

FAQs about HDPE Duct Spacers

1. What is an HDPE duct spacer?

HDPE duct spacers are specialized components made from high-density polyethylene (HDPE) designed to maintain the proper spacing and alignment of ducts in various installations. They are used in applications such as construction, telecommunications, utilities, and agriculture.

2. What are the advantages of using HDPE duct spacers?

Some key advantages of HDPE duct spacers include:

1. Durability: HDPE is resistant to environmental factors, chemicals, and physical impacts.

2. Lightweight: This makes installation easier and more efficient.

3. Corrosion Resistance: Unlike metal spacers, HDPE does not corrode, extending its lifespan.

4. Cost-Effective: Reduced maintenance needs lead to lower long-term costs.

5. Environmental Impact: HDPE is recyclable, making it a more sustainable choice.
